低代码平台(Low-Code Platforms)作为一种新兴的技术趋势,正在逐渐改变软件开发和业务流程的构建方式。本文将深入探讨低代码平台的概念、优势、应用场景以及如何利用它们加速敏捷开发,重塑企业创新之路。
一、低代码平台概述
1.1 定义
低代码平台是一种可视化的软件开发环境,它允许开发者通过拖放组件和配置属性来快速构建应用程序,而不需要编写大量的代码。这种平台通常提供预构建的模块和模板,使得非技术背景的用户也能参与到应用开发过程中。
1.2 发展背景
随着数字化转型的加速,企业对软件的需求日益增长,但传统的软件开发模式往往周期长、成本高。低代码平台的兴起,正是为了解决这一痛点。
二、低代码平台的优势
2.1 提高开发效率
低代码平台通过简化开发流程,减少了编码工作量,从而显著提高了开发效率。以下是一些具体优势:
- 可视化开发:开发者可以通过图形界面进行操作,无需编写代码。
- 模块化设计:平台提供丰富的模块和组件,可以快速组合成复杂的应用。
- 跨平台支持:低代码平台通常支持多种操作系统和设备,提高了应用的兼容性。
2.2 降低开发成本
低代码平台降低了开发门槛,使得企业可以以更低的成本获得高质量的应用程序。以下是降低成本的具体方式:
- 减少人力成本:非技术背景的用户可以参与开发,降低对专业开发者的依赖。
- 缩短开发周期:快速构建应用,减少等待时间,降低时间成本。
2.3 增强业务敏捷性
低代码平台使得企业能够快速响应市场变化,及时调整业务流程。以下是增强业务敏捷性的具体表现:
- 快速迭代:低代码平台支持快速开发和迭代,帮助企业快速适应市场变化。
- 灵活调整:平台提供的模块化和可配置性,使得企业可以灵活调整应用功能。
三、低代码平台的应用场景
3.1 企业内部应用
- 办公自动化:如审批流程、报销系统等。
- 客户关系管理:如销售线索管理、客户服务系统等。
3.2 供应链管理
- 库存管理:实时监控库存,优化库存策略。
- 物流跟踪:实时跟踪物流信息,提高物流效率。
3.3 教育行业
- 在线学习平台:提供个性化学习体验。
- 考试系统:实现在线考试和成绩管理。
四、如何利用低代码平台加速敏捷开发
4.1 选择合适的低代码平台
- 功能需求:根据企业实际需求,选择功能丰富的低代码平台。
- 用户体验:选择界面友好、易于使用的平台。
- 生态系统:选择拥有强大生态系统的平台,便于获取支持和资源。
4.2 建立跨部门协作
- 明确角色分工:明确开发、测试、运维等角色的职责。
- 定期沟通:加强团队间的沟通,确保项目顺利进行。
4.3 持续迭代和优化
- 快速反馈:收集用户反馈,及时调整应用功能。
- 持续优化:根据业务需求,不断优化应用性能和用户体验。
五、总结
低代码平台作为一种新兴的技术趋势,正在改变软件开发和业务流程的构建方式。通过提高开发效率、降低开发成本和增强业务敏捷性,低代码平台有助于企业重塑创新之路。在未来的发展中,低代码平台将继续发挥重要作用,推动企业数字化转型。
